long line definition

long line means a length of line to which is attached one or more traces or hooks and which is anchored and buoyed at one or both ends;
long line. Any combination of load and line, attached to the cargo hook of the aircraft for the purpose of carrying an external load greater than 50 feet in length.
long line means a line or cable, usually 30-70m in length, used to connect the helicopter to the external load.

More Definitions of long line

long line means a fishing line to which numbers of hooks, baited or otherwise, are attached at intervals and which is hung in water in a fixed position;
long line means a fishing line with a series of hooks on separate but attached short lines. It can be anchored or drifted. It may also be known as a trot line or set line.
